Boasting mullion windows, exposed stonework and wooden beams
Mullion windows, exposed stonework and wooden beams bring character in abundance to this pretty cottage, whilst two wood burning stoves and a cottage garden make The Nook a perfect Cotswolds retreat all year round.
The large, bright entrance hall leads straight through the cottage, past the ground floor bathroom to the spacious and well-equipped kitchen with separate dining room, complete with wood burning stove and doors to the rear garden.
The cosy sitting room is dominated by a beautiful inglenook fire place and can be accessed from the cottage's original hallway where you will also find the wooden staircase leading to the first floor and two tastefully furnished bedrooms; bedroom one with the option of either a super-king or twin single beds; a king-size bed in bedroom two; as well as a family shower room. A small door leads up a few stairs to the top floor bedroom with another king-size bed and views of the rear garden.
The cottage boasts a small front garden with views across the rolling hills, ideal for that morning coffee. The rear garden is totally enclosed and is ideal for alfresco dining after a day exploring the Cotswolds.
Additional Information: Sorry, no pets. Children and babies welcome (two stairgates available free of charge and on request). Please provide your own travel cot and highchair if required. The bedding is non-feather. Exposed beams and stonework. There are low beams and doorways throughout. Please be aware of two level changes on the ground floor. The rear garden has a small covered pond, different levels and steep drops, so children should be supervised at all times. The path in-between the house and the front garden is access to all properties in the row.
